How to Prevent Catastrophic Failure
To avoid ruin:
- Choose steel based on service conditions: Confirm environmental factors like temperature extremes and chemical exposure.
- Conduct thorough material certification: Ensure the steel batch includes full fracture toughness data.
- Implement fatigue-resistant designs: Use stress-relief features, smooth transitions, and avoid sharp notches.
- Schedule regular inspections: Use ultrasound or radiography to detect early fatigue damage.
- Consult material experts: Leverage metallurgists familiar with rare alloys’ unique behaviors.
